Today’s newspapers are flooded with reports on Sanjay Dutt’s mixed verdict yesterday. But the mood is upbeat amongst the film fraternity. On one hand he was acquitted from the Tada court, but was held guilty under the arms act section 3 and 7 for possession of an AK-56 rifle, a prohibited weapon and a pistol. Under section seven, he is liable for a maximum of ten years in jail or a minimum of five
